Description
Many health problems are unique to, more common in, or more severe in women than men.
This book examines the underpinnings of these gender differences.
Sections deal with biological (hormonal, anatomic, immunologic, and pregnancy-related), social, behavioural/psychological, and lifestyle influences.
Chapters are heavily referenced, packed full with data, and they provide methodological insights that will guide future women's health research.
